(C 및 포인터) #if 0/#if 1...#end if

607 단어
하나."#if 0/#if 1...#endif"역할
1) 코드에 정의된 디버그 버전의 코드는 컴파일러가 완전히 무시합니다.코드가 적용되려면 #if 0을 #if 1로 변경하십시오
2) #if0의 또 하나의 중요한 용도는 주석으로 사용하는 것이다. 만약에 주석을 원하는 프로그램이 길다면 이때 #if0이 가장 좋다. 실수를 하지 않도록 한다.
#if 1은 그 사이의 변수를 로컬 변수로 만들 수 있습니다.
3) 이 구조는 이전에 작성한 코드가 지금은 사용할 수 없고 삭제하고 싶지 않다는 것을 나타낸다. 이 방법으로 주석보다 편리하다.
둘.예.
 
  
#include  
int main(void) 

    int a = 0; 
    #if 0 
    a = 1; 
    #endif 

    printf("%d
",a); 
    return 0; 
}

좋은 웹페이지 즐겨찾기